STAR Trial Summary
This trial is testing a new treatment for prostate cancer that has come back after previous radiation therapy.

Study Objectives
Outcome measures can provide a clearer picture of what you can expect from a treatment.Primary outcome measures
absence of biochemical failure, defined as achieving a PSA nadir of ≤ 0.5 ng/mL within 12 months of treatment
Secondary outcome measures
negative prostate biopsy at the 12 month time point
